Abstract: An electric dust collecting filter includes a plurality of film electrodes that are arranged apart from each other at regular intervals and form an electric field to collect foreign matter in the air. The film electrode includes an insulating part that defines one surface and the other surface of the film electrode, a first electrode part disposed on one side inside the insulating part and having a plurality of first wire electrodes spaced apart from each other, and a second electrode part disposed on the other side inside the insulating part and having a plurality of second wire electrodes that are disposed between the plurality of first wire electrodes spaced apart from each other and provided alternately with the plurality of first wire electrodes.

Abstract: A method of controlling a washing machine includes rotating a motor for driving an inner shaft in a first direction, and aligning a clutch to a reference position corresponding to one of a maximum lowered position and a maximum raised position. The motor is rotated by a preset reference alignment angle in a second direction to align the clutch from the reference position to a starting position corresponding to one of an upper limit and a lower limit of a preset agitating control section. The upper limit of the agitating control section is spaced downward by a first distance from the maximum raised position, and the lower limit of the agitating control section is spaced upward by a second distance from the maximum lowered position. The motor is rotated by a starting alignment angle set according to a displacement of the clutch ranging from the starting position to a target position corresponding to the other one of the upper limit and the lower limit so that the clutch is moved from the starting position to the target position.

Abstract: The present invention relates to a washing machine including an outer tub which accommodates wash water, an inner tub which is disposed in the outer tub to accommodate laundry, and which rotates around a vertical axis, a motor which provides torque, an outer shaft which has a hollow, and which rotates the inner tub, an inner shaft which rotates inside the hollow by the motor, a pulsator which is disposed in the inner tub and is connected to the inner shaft, and a clutch which is screw-coupled to the inner shaft in the hollow formed at the outer shaft, and which is engaged with the outer shaft so as to be raised by the rotation of the inner shaft.

Abstract: A refrigerator may include a body having a freezing chamber and a refrigeration chamber, a cooling circuit for cooling the freezing chamber and the refrigeration chamber, and a power source for supplying power to the cooling circuit. The refrigerator may further include a thermosyphon provided between the freezing chamber and refrigerating chamber. A control circuit may be connected to the thermosyphon to control a flow of refrigerant in the thermosyphon. The control circuit may include a valve provided on a circulation path of the thermosyphon, a electrical power storage device connected between the power source and the valve, and a switching circuit provided between the valve and the electrical power storage device. When the power source does not supply power to the cooling circuit, the control circuit may operate the thermosyphon using power stored in the electrical power storage device.

Abstract: A refrigerator is provided. The refrigerator may include a body having storage chambers formed therein, and a compressor, a condenser, an expansion device, and an evaporator that form a refrigerating cycle to cool the storage chambers. The condenser may include a refrigerant condensation channel through which refrigerant from the compressor passes and a working fluid evaporation channel through which working fluid is evaporated due to heat exchange with the refrigerant passing through the refrigerant condensation channel. The condenser may be connected with a hot line, through which the working fluid evaporated through the working fluid evaporation channel flows and discharges heat to reduce condensation.

Abstract: A shoe care device includes an inner cabinet that has an accommodation space configured to accommodate shoes therein, an inlet defined at a first portion of the accommodation space and configured to supply air to the accommodation space, and an outlet defined at a second portion of the accommodation space and configured to suction air from the accommodation space. The shoe care device further includes a connection path configured to circulate air between the inlet and the outlet, a blowing fan disposed at the connection path and configured to blow air from the outlet toward the inlet, a dehumidifying material disposed at the connection path and configured to dehumidify the air blown by the blowing fan, a heater configured to heat the dehumidifying material, and a regeneration path configured to guide, to a location other than the inlet, the air having passed through the dehumidifying material heated by the heater.

Abstract: A shoe care device includes an inner cabinet, an air supply device that is configured to blow air to an accommodated space of the inner cabinet and includes a plurality of dehumidifying materials separate from one another, and a controller configured to control the air supply device. The air supply device includes a connection path configured to circulate air between an inlet and an outlet of the inner cabinet, and a regeneration path branched from the connection path and configured to guide air having passed through at least one of the dehumidifying materials to a portion of the air supply device other than the inlet. The controller is configured to control the air supply device to selectively open and close at least one of the connection path or the regeneration path based on whether or not at least one of the dehumidifying materials is heated.

Abstract: A clothing processing apparatus according to an embodiment of the present disclosure may include a cabinet having a receiving space formed therein, in which clothing is received, a holder configured to be located in the receiving space to hold a clothing supporter configured to support the clothing, a steamer configured to spray steam toward the clothing while elevating inside the receiving space in the vertical direction, an elevating motor configured to provide an elevating power of the steamer, and a tilting motor configured to rotate the holder so that the arm of the clothing droops downward to be separated from the body.

Abstract: The present invention relates to a washing machine comprising an outer tub containing water, and an inner tub disposed in the outer tub to accommodate laundry and rotated about a horizontal axis. The washing machine includes: a motor for providing rotational force; an outer shaft that has a first hollow, and rotates the inner tub; an inner shaft disposed in the first hollow and rotated by the motor; a pulsator disposed in the inner tub and coupled with the inner shaft; a planetary gear train for transmitting rotational force of the motor; a carrier mover which has an outer circumferential surface that is spline-coupled to an inner circumferential surface of the outer shaft, and an inner circumferential surface that is screwed with an outer circumferential surface of the clutch carrier; and a stopper restricting movement of the carrier mover, thereby achieving various washing modes with a simple mechanism by rotating the inner tub and the pulsator.
